#include<stdio.h>
int process[100],burst[100];
void sort(n)
{
for(int i=0;i<n-1;i++)
{
for(int j=0;j<n-1-i;j++)
{
if(burst[j]>burst[j+1])
{
int temp=burst[j];
burst[j]=burst[j+1];
burst[j+1]=temp;
temp=process[j];
process[j]=process[j+1];
process[j+1]=temp;
}
}
}
}
int main()
{
printf("enter number of process : ");
int n,i,j;
scanf("%d",&n);
printf("Enter process and burst time : \n");
for(i=0;i<n;i++)
{
scanf("%d%d",&process[i],&burst[i]);
}
sort(n);
int turn[n];
turn[0]=burst[0];
int wt[n];
wt[0]=0;
double avet=0.0;
double avew=0.0;
for(i=1;i<n;i++)
{
turn[i]=turn[i-1]+burst[i];
avet+=(double)(turn[i]);
wt[i]=turn[i]-burst[i];
avew+=(double)wt[i];
}
printf("process\t\tturn around time\t\t\twaiting time\n");
for(i=0;i<n;i++)
{
printf("%d\t\t\t%d\t\t\t\t\t%d\n",process[i],turn[i],wt[i]);
}
printf("\naverage turn around time is : %.2lf\n",avet);
printf("\naverage waiting time is : %.2lf\n",avew);
return 0;
}
